Output 77282934100020ed0ab9cc64c29267d2cc9ff31c16072fab3e352d4231062e91:0

value
331596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8abdf62889d55182a55aa454d657f296e44febb OP_EQUAL
address
3Kz4xpw8DqeAwYL1m93VABP7MUw6Efdprb
transaction
77282934100020ed0ab9cc64c29267d2cc9ff31c16072fab3e352d4231062e91
spent
true